Abstract
An electrospun nanofibrous membrane is sheet like and is formed by multiple glucose oxidase/potassium hexacyanoferrate(III) modified electrospun nanofibers. The glucose oxidase/potassium hexacyanoferrate(III) modified electrospun nanofibers are PVA electrospun nanofibers containing glucose oxidase and potassium hexacyanoferrate(III) homogeneously dispersed therein. The glucose oxidase/potassium hexacyanoferrate(III) modified electrospun nanofibers are PVA electrospun nanofibers and are cross-linked by glutaraldehyde vapor with ultrasonic energy assistance. Graphene modified PVA/GOx electrospun membranes were prepared to examine the immobilization mechanism between graphene and GOx. The electrochemical measurement results show that the sensitivities increased with increasing graphene concentrations up to 20 ppm. The highest sensitivity recorded 38.7 μA/mM was for a PVA/GOx membrane with 20 ppm graphene representing a 109% increase over a membrane made without graphene.
